"Barbecue is a symbol of American ingenuity. It transforms cheap, tough cuts of meat into tender bites of heaven with nothing but time, smoke, heat, and a few spices. Serve this smoky pulled pork like they do in North Carolina--with some slaw on top of the sandwich...."
INGREDIENTS
•
1 tablespoon Hungarian sweet paprika
•
1 tablespoon Spanish smoked paprika
•
1 tablespoon light brown sugar
•
1 teaspoon salt
•
1 teaspoon onion powder
•
1 teaspoon dry mustard
•
1 teaspoon black pepper
•
1 teaspoon ground red pepper
•
1 (4 1/2-pound) bone-in pork shoulder (Boston butt)
•
7 1/2 cups hickory wood chips
•
Cooking spray
•
2 cups cider vinegar
•
3/4 cup low-sodium ketchup
•
1/2 cup water
•
2 tablespoons granulated sugar
•
1 tablespoon hot pepper sauce
•
1 teaspoon salt
•
1 teaspoon crushed red pepper
•
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
•
1 (16-ounce) package cabbage-and-carrot coleslaw
•
15 (1 1/2-ounce) whole-wheat hamburger buns
